~*~
Old stories told
Thru' endless weaving,
Their tales of woe,
Of loss and grieving.

History rich
With native cultures,
Their broken bones
Were picked by vultures.

A peoples proud
Lost way of living,
Lost their land,
So nature giving.

Nations noble
Began disbanding,
With broken spirits,
Not understanding.

***

An august people
Once brimming pride,
Were then dispersed
Through country wide.

Ancestors sing
Of glories past,
Their ways of living,
And their outcast.

Winds do carry
Their soulful song,
Sung by spirits
Forever strong.
~*~
